Fender fans would love the Fender Stratocaster Coffee Table design for their home or studio. This table is officially licensed by Fender and built to Fender design specifications. Made of solid maple, it’s designed to resemble the original Fender headstock design. Guitar Center sells one for $250 but the color is slightly different and might be made out of a different type of wood.

The new Semi-hollow electric Taylor T3/B is in the cover of Premier Magazine April 2009 issue.

“The T3/B is not a ‘jack of all trades, master of none,’ but rather a well-thought-out instrument that plays great, sounds fantastic and looks incredible,” reviewer Steve Ouimette declares early on. He loved the “comfortable and fast-playing” neck, which he says “combined the best of all neck shapes into one, and lent itself to just about any style of playing.”

Pop/Country singer Jewel injured her knees while rehearsing for Dancing with the Stars but confirmed that she will not back down from the competition.

According to her blog, the singer suffered tendinitis on both knees while practicing for the show but her doctor says that she will be okay for next week.

Jewel says “Don’t count me out as I am in this for the long run.”

Organizers confirmed that the British band Oasis canceled their China tour.

The band was scheduled to perform in Beijing and Shanghai in April and would have marked the band’s first show in China.

The ticket sales were halted February 28 and refund information would be announced later.

There was no explanation given for the cancellation of the shows.

The group is currently on a world tour promoting their latest album “Dig Out Your Soul.”

Last month, Oasis wrote on their official website that they were excited to announce their first ever shows in mainland China as part of their world tour.
